During the past two Ethiopian Fiscal Years (2010/2011 and 2011/2012) real GDP growth of 11.6% and 8.5 % have respectively been registered. The share of industry in total GDP has increased from 10.8% at base year to 15% in 2010 / 2011. The average double digit growth that has been registered puts Ethiopia in the list of fastest growing countries of the world. Read more »

February 10, 2012 – Ethiopian Airlines was awarded the Gold Award for African Airline of the Year 2011/2012 from the African Aviation News portal. Ethiopian Airlines earned this distinguished honor by receiving the highest number of votes from readers, industry officials, and followers of African Aviation. More than 20,000 total votes were registered in this year's poll, both online and in various industry meetings and airline congress events.  Read more  »

WASHINGTON & ENGLEWOOD, Colo.--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- The Western Union Company (NYSE:WU - News), a leader in global payment services, its Foundation, and the United States Agency for International Development (USAID) have extended the application deadline for the African Diaspora Marketplace to February 15, 2012. The ADM is an initiative that encourages sustainable economic growth and employment by supporting U.S.-based diaspora entrepreneurs with ideas for start-up and established businesses in Africa. Western Union Agent and pan-African banking group Ecobank Group also announces its intention to join the second African Diaspora Marketplace (ADM).   Read more »
